Oracle データベースには、数値型、文字型、日付型など、一般的なデータ型が多数あります。いくつかの一般的なデータ型を、対応するコード例とともに以下で詳しく紹介します。
- 数値データ型:
- NUMBER: 数値型データの格納に使用され、必要に応じて精度と範囲を指定できます。
例: CREATE TABLE test_table (
id NUMBER(10),
給与 NUMBER(8,2)
);
- INTEGER: ストレージに使用されます整数型のデータ。
例: CREATE TABLE test_table (
id INTEGER,
age INTEGER
);
- 文字データ型:
- VARCHAR2: 使用最大長 4000 バイトの可変長文字データを格納します。
例: CREATE TABLE test_table (
name VARCHAR2(50),
address VARCHAR2(100)
);
- CHAR: 固定長の格納に使用されます文字データの欠落部分はスペースで埋められます。
例: CREATE TABLE test_table (
code CHAR(5),
status CHAR(10)
);
- Date データ型:
- DATE: 日付と時刻のデータを保存するために使用されます。
例: CREATE TABLE test_table (
recruit_date DATE,
Birth_date DATE
);
- TIMESTAMP: 日付、時刻、およびタイムゾーン情報を保存するために使用されます。
例: CREATE TABLE test_table (
order_time TIMESTAMP,
delivery_time TIMESTAMP
);
- その他の一般的なデータ型:
- CLOB:大量のテキスト データを保存するために使用されます。
例: CREATE TABLE test_table (
description CLOB
);
- BLOB: 大量のバイナリ データを格納するために使用されます。
例: CREATE TABLE test_table (
image BLOB
);
上記は、Oracle データベースでの一般的なデータ型とそのコード例です。さまざまなデータ型が、さまざまな用途に適しています。データ ストレージ要件に応じて、適切なデータ タイプを選択して、実際の状況に応じてデータベース テーブルを作成できます。
以上がOracle データベースの一般的なデータ型は何です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。